Build Synergistic Learning Relationships

The foundation of transformational learning lies not in methods or materials, but in the quality of relationships we create with our learners. Think of Dale Chihuly, the renowned glass sculptor who revolutionized his art by bringing together teams of skilled artisans. Rather than working alone, Chihuly discovered that combining individual talents through collaborative effort produced masterpieces that none could achieve independently. This artistic synergy mirrors what happens when educators and learners truly connect as partners in the learning journey. Consider the story of Professor David Wilson at UC Davis, whose simple question changed everything for one struggling student. When he asked, "How are we going to bring out the brilliance in you?" he wasn't just teaching content; he was awakening potential. That student, who had spent years hiding in the background, afraid to speak up or stand out, suddenly found herself challenged to see herself through different eyes. Wilson refused to accept surface-level responses, pushing her to dig deeper and discover her authentic voice. The transformation wasn't immediate, but it was profound and lasting. This interaction demonstrates the power of the 70/30 principle, where learners do 70 percent of the talking while educators facilitate just 30 percent. When we reverse the traditional dynamic and get learners actively engaged in discussion, teaching each other, and working through challenges together, we create an environment where brilliance can emerge naturally. The educator's role becomes one of catalyst and guide, asking provocative questions and creating safe spaces for risk-taking and growth. To build these synergistic relationships, start by genuinely knowing your learners as individuals. Greet them personally, learn their stories, and understand their goals and challenges. Create opportunities for them to share their expertise with others, recognizing that everyone brings valuable knowledge to the table. Assume positive intent even when behaviors seem challenging, and remember that resistance often masks fear or past negative experiences. Your belief in their potential becomes a powerful force for transformation.

Craft Content That Truly Connects

Content that sings doesn't just inform; it transforms by connecting abstract concepts to concrete, lived experiences. The key lies in making the invisible visible through stories, examples, and frameworks that learners can grasp and apply immediately. When teaching the concept of giving and receiving, imagine transforming a simple poetry lesson into an unforgettable experience. Picture students receiving beautifully wrapped gifts, not knowing what lies inside, as they explore their feelings and reactions to the act of receiving. This approach began with carefully crafted packages, each wrapped differently, handed out with genuine care and attention. As students held their unopened gifts, they were asked to write about their immediate thoughts and feelings. The room buzzed with energy as they shared experiences about gift-giving traditions, expectations, and disappointments. Only after this rich exploration of their own experiences were they invited to open their gifts and discover Kahlil Gibran's poem "On Giving" inside. The magic happened when students connected their personal experiences with the universal themes in the poetry. They didn't need to be told what the poem meant; they discovered its significance through their own reflection and discussion. Their insights emerged naturally from the intersection of their lived experiences and the text. This process demonstrated that when learners arrive at understanding through their own exploration, the learning becomes deeply embedded and personally meaningful. Create models and frameworks that serve as mental scaffolding for complex concepts. The THRIVE model for hiring, for example, transforms abstract hiring principles into a memorable acronym covering Title, Heart, Results, Important skills, Values, and Excellence. Develop clear job aids that learners can reference and apply immediately. Focus on extreme clarity in your core message, ensuring you can articulate your main points concisely and compellingly. Remember that clear content gives the brain a challenging target to focus on, while confusion creates barriers to learning.

Master the ENGAGE Learning Model

The ENGAGE Model represents a systematic approach to creating learning experiences that stick. This six-step process ensures that learning moves from temporary awareness to lasting transformation through deliberate design and implementation. Unlike traditional methods that rely heavily on information delivery, ENGAGE emphasizes active participation, meaning-making, and real-world application throughout the entire learning journey. Take the example of a coach certification program that exemplified this model perfectly. Participants received pre-work that energized them and prepared their minds for learning. Upon arrival, they were immediately challenged with real coaching scenarios rather than lengthy introductions. The content was navigated through demonstration, practice, and peer feedback. Participants generated personal meaning by connecting coaching skills to their own goals and values. They applied learning through supervised practice with actual clients, and their competence was gauged through live coaching demonstrations. The program extended far beyond the classroom through ongoing support, roundtables, and advanced learning opportunities. Years later, participants continued to grow and develop their skills through a community of practice that emerged from their shared learning experience. This demonstrates how the ENGAGE model creates not just individual transformation but entire communities of learners who support each other's continued growth. Each step builds deliberately on the previous one, creating momentum and depth. Energize learners by capturing their attention and connecting to their existing knowledge. Navigate content through interactive experiences that honor different learning styles. Generate meaning by helping learners discover personal relevance and value. Apply to real-world situations with guided practice and feedback. Gauge and celebrate progress to build confidence and motivation. Extend learning through ongoing support and community building.

Extend Learning Into Lasting Action

The true measure of any learning experience lies not in what happens during the session, but in the lasting changes that occur afterward. Too often, people leave workshops or presentations with great intentions but lack the support systems and accountability structures necessary to turn insights into habits. The most powerful learning initiatives create mechanisms that extend far beyond the formal learning time, ensuring that transformation continues long after the last slide is presented. Consider the impact of a simple accountability partner system. One participant in a leadership program committed to writing an article about disciplining for character development, setting a two-month deadline and sharing this goal with a learning buddy. When life's demands interfered and two months passed without progress, that partner's phone call provided the gentle push needed to reignite commitment. Within two weeks, not only was the article completed, but it launched a three-year column-writing opportunity that impacted thousands of educators. This story illustrates the profound difference between good intentions and sustained action. The learning buddy didn't provide expertise or detailed guidance; they simply maintained accountability and offered encouragement at a crucial moment. This type of support structure costs nothing to implement but dramatically increases the likelihood of follow-through and long-term success. Effective extension strategies include immediate follow-up within 24-48 hours, buddy systems that create mutual accountability, success story sharing that maintains community momentum, and ongoing learning opportunities like lunch sessions or virtual refreshers. Create clear action plans with specific deadlines and accountability measures. Link learning to business outcomes and celebrate progress publicly. Consider providing mentors from previous programs who can offer guidance and encouragement based on their own successful application of the concepts.

Summary

The journey from traditional teaching to transformational learning requires courage, commitment, and a fundamental belief in human potential. As we've explored throughout this approach, the secret lies not in having all the answers, but in asking the right questions and creating environments where brilliance can emerge naturally. The most powerful insight here challenges everything we thought we knew about effective teaching: "Whoever is doing the talking is doing the learning." When we embrace this principle fully, we stop being performers and become facilitators of transformation. We create spaces where learners discover their own wisdom, connect with their deepest motivations, and support each other's growth. The ENGAGE model provides the structure, but the magic happens in the moments when a learner's eyes light up with understanding, when someone finds their voice for the first time, or when a community of practice emerges from shared learning experiences.
